Guys thanks for your assistance in getting this mower all back together. After a couple of hours work it is now running very nicely and most importantly not leaking any oil around the valve chest cover.
I ended up using all the new parts as you indicated AVB. The valve guides were very easy to replace onto the new metal plate.
I ended up lapping the valves before re-assembly however they were already in quite good condition. It was surprising to note the inside of the bore was unmarked which I found surprising for a mower that was 10 plus years old.
